I was appointed as the Associate Dean of Research in the School of Medical and Health Sciences in 2016. My teaching and research interests have focused on increasing our understanding of developmental genes and their involvement in cell proliferation, specification and migration. I have studied their expression and regulatory functions in embryogenesis and in adults from several different phyla and have utilised mutant mouse models to aid understanding. In particular my research has centred on delineation of the importance of developmental genes in specification of melanoblasts, in malignant melanoma cells and in neurogenesis. Melanoma is a central research focus. I have received funding from the NHMRC, ARC, Rotary WA, Cancer Council of WA, CaPCREU, Lotterywest and the OLT to support my research.
Forming a teaching and learning and research nexus has also been a focus of my career for many years. I have taught undergraduate students and supervised postgraduate students and coordinated units and courses as well as the Honours and Postgraduate courses.
My research team currently comprises 4 postdoctoral researchers, 4 research assistants, and 10 postgraduate students (6 PhDs, 2 MSc and 2 Hons). During my career I have supervised several postgraduate students to completion (13 PhDs, 8 MScs and 14 BSc Hons). Several PhD graduates have secured excellent postdoctoral positions in prestigious laboratories worldwide including Cambridge University UK, Kings College London UK, Columbia University NY USA, University of Pennsylvania USA, Curtin University and UWA.
I have published over 100 papers, and have been an invited speaker at several international conferences. I am a member of the scientific advisory board of the Cancer Council of WA and a member of the Board of Huntington’s WA. I was a member of the Parliamentary Standing Committee on Health - Skin cancer in Australia in 2014.
I established the Edith Cowan University Melanoma Research Group in 2007 and the Huntington's disease research group in 2010. I have served on ALTC and NHMRC grant review panels for several years. I am the past West Australian state representative for the ANZ Society of Cell and Developmental Biology and have been/am an enthusiastic conference organising committee member for several conferences.
I promote science to the community, giving talks and demonstrations to adults and school students and community clubs. I also organise melanoma awareness talks for the general public and skin cancer screening programs for companies.
